Demystifying 5kVA Solar System Prices: Your 2025 Buyer’s Guide

Ever felt like decoding solar system prices requires an astrophysics degree? Let’s cut through the tech jargon and explore what really drives costs for 5kVA solar systems – the Goldilocks zone of residential energy solutions. Spoiler alert: It’s not rocket science, but you’ll want to keep your calculator handy.

What’s Cooking in the 5kVA Solar Market?

The solar industry’s moving faster than a photon racing to Earth. Last month, a client in Texas scored a 5kW system with battery backup for $8,900 – that’s 18% cheaper than 2024 averages. But here’s the kicker: Prices swing wider than a pendulum at a physics convention based on three key ingredients:

  • Panel pedigree: N-type panels now dominate 63% of new installations
  • Battery drama: LFP batteries are the new rock stars, lasting 6,000+ cycles
  • Smart tech: 87% of inverters now come with AI-driven energy management

Breaking Down the 5kVA Solar System Cost Puzzle

Let’s play solar detective. A typical 5kVA system (that’s 5,000 watts for us Earthlings) might include:

  • 15 x 335W solar panels doing the heavy lifting
  • 1 x hybrid inverter moonlighting as energy traffic cop
  • Batteries? Optional but pricey – like adding caviar to your energy buffet

Current market whispers suggest: Grid-tied systems: $7,500-$11,000
Hybrid systems: $12,000-$16,000
Off-grid warriors: $18,000+ (You’re basically building a power plant in your backyard)

The Secret Sauce of Solar Pricing

Why does Mrs. Johnson pay $9.2k in Arizona while Mr. Lee shells out $13.7k in Alaska? It’s not just about polar bears vs. cacti. Three hidden factors are pulling the strings:

1. The Great Component Quality Debate

  • Tier 1 panels vs. “Bargain Bin Specials” – difference of $1.2k+ per system
  • Microinverters vs. string inverters – choose your energy management adventure
  • MPPT controllers – the unsung heroes stealing 10-25% efficiency gains

2. Installation Tango: Roofs vs. Ground vs. Carports

Recent data from SolarTech Insights reveals:
Simple roof install: $0.85/W
Ground mount: Adds $1.10/W (Basically paying for a steel farm)
Carport systems: $2.35/W (Your Prius finally earns its keep)

Pro Tips for Solar Shoppers

  • Timing is everything – Q3 installations average 9% cheaper than Q1
  • Bundling storage later? That’s like buying half a bicycle – possible but awkward
  • Watch for “Solar Coaster” pricing – tariffs and supply chains are wilder than a rodeo

Remember that viral TikTok about the “solar price whisperer”? Turns out haggling can slash 12-18% off quotes. Pro move: Ask about “last year’s models” – they’re often just differently labeled boxes with identical specs.
